I’ve had the same problem last week when trying to activate an SGP license on a computer with an instance of SGP that had a expired trial license. Nothing really helpful in the log files other than activation failed with an “unknown error”. In the end I have uninstalled SGP, removed the SGP program folders, rebooted the computer and went for a clean install. Then I could activate SGP and restore the preferred configuration from a backup. Hope this helps.
